On January 29, 1993, a group of financial executives rang the opening bell at the American Stock Exchange to launch the SPDR S&P 500 ETF (SPY) — the first ETF ever listed in the United States. More than three decades later, SPY remains the most heavily traded ETF in the world, trading at a higher daily volume than even the largest individual stock in the S&P 500.

The concept of an exchange-traded fund originated in Canada in 1990. What started as a single product tracking a broad stock index has since expanded to more than 14,000 ETFs globally, covering equities, bonds, commodities, currencies, and thematic strategies. Unlike mutual funds, ETFs trade throughout the day on stock exchanges at fluctuating market prices.

The most traded ETFs by options and share volume span several categories:

  • Broad U.S. equity: SPY (S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ust), QQQ (Invesco QQQ Trust tracking the Nasdaq-100)
  • Small caps: IWM (iShares Russell 2000 ETF)
  • Leveraged & inverse: TQQQ (ProShares UltraPro QQQ 3x), SQQQ (ProShares UltraPro Short QQQ –3x)
  • Fixed income: TLT (iShares 20+ Year Treasury Bond ETF), HYG (iShares High Yield Corporate Bond ETF)
  • Commodities: GLD (SPDR Gold Shares), SLV (iShares Silver Trust)
  • International: EEM (iShares MSCI Emerging Markets ETF)

ETF liquidity is maintained through a creation and redemption mechanism involving authorized participants — large institutional firms that assemble or disassemble baskets of underlying securities in blocks of roughly 50,000 shares. This process keeps an ETF’s market price closely aligned with the net asset value of its holdings.
